Herringbone pattern across old kitchen timber floor and new cement floor in extension?
Anonymous user 28/02/2024 - 4.00 PM
Hi, We have a kitchen extension currently under way, the kitchen floor is timber and extension is concrete. Total area 50sqm We hoped to place a herringbone pattern in wood effect tiles - size- 15x90. 6mm thick. We are aware of the need for an expansion joint between the two substrates to help prevent cracking/tiles lifting, however we have been advised to avoid herringbone due to the possibility of the timber floor not being level which could throw the square off and cause issues in the middle? are there any concerns with what has been said or would anyone have concerns with the projected plan? Could we level the timber floor and how would this be done? Thanks
